The slag plays a crucial role in the electroslag remelting (ESR) process. ESR is a metal refining technique that uses the heat generated by electric current passing through the slag to melt and refine metal materials. In this process, the role of the slag is indispensable, and its importance is reflected in the following aspects:
1. Heat Generation and Transfer: In the ESR process, the slag first absorbs the heat generated by the electric current and then transfers the heat to the metal raw materials through heat conduction, causing them to melt. The thermal conductivity and heat capacity of the slag are crucial for the effective transfer and uniform distribution of heat.
2. Refining Action: The chemical reactions between the slag and the molten metal help remove impurities and harmful gases from the metal. The components in the slag can react with these harmful substances to form insoluble or gaseous substances, thereby purifying the metal.
3. Slag Shell Formation: In the ESR process, the slag forms a slag shell on the surface of the metal, effectively preventing metal oxidation and nitridation. This is crucial for ensuring the quality and performance of the metal.
4. Electromagnetic Stability: The presence of slag helps stabilize the electromagnetic field in the ESR process, ensuring that the current is uniformly distributed in the metal, thereby ensuring the stability of the remelting process and the uniformity of the metal.
5. Process Control: The composition and properties of the slag can be adjusted to meet the different ESR process requirements. For example, by changing the melting point and viscosity of the slag, the heating rate and melting behavior of the metal can be controlled.
6. Environmental Protection: The slag in the ESR process can also play a certain role in environmental protection. It can absorb and fix harmful substances produced during metal smelting, reducing environmental pollution.
In summary, the slag in the ESR process not only plays a role in transferring heat and refining metal, but also participates in multiple aspects such as metal protection, process control, and environmental protection. Its importance cannot be ignored; it is of great significance to improving metal quality, optimizing process performance, reducing energy consumption, and reducing environmental pollution. In practical applications, appropriate slag types and parameters should be selected according to the specific metal materials and process requirements.
